For the first time since the beginning of August, following the Summer break, FIA Formula 2 returns to racing action this weekend with a trip to Monza. The "Temple of Speed" as it is referred to by many passionate motorsport fans, with the continuous long straights and very few multi corner complexes, will play host to round 11 of 14 in 2025. It is the second Italian venue of the 2025 FIA Formula 2 Championship and will close the European part of the season, following the other Italian venue, Imola, opening it up back in May. Arriving to Monza, with a big home crowd in attendance, Leonardo Fornaroli will have eyes very much laid upon him. The 2024 FIA Formula 3 Champion, who clinched glory at Monza 12 months ago, has the Formula 2 championship lead heading into round 11. Fornaroli has a 17-point lead over DAMS Lucas Oil and Aston Martin Development driver Jak Crawford, who is second in the standings. Richard Verschoor is third in the standings and is 19 points off the championship lead with Luke Browning and Alex Dunne not far away within the top five. Dunne will be featuring in two championships across the weekend at Monza with the McLaren Development Driver set to participate in the Formula One Free Practice One session. The Irishman will step into Oscar Piastri's McLaren on Friday afternoon to get some more experience behind the Formula One car. Fornaroli, who races for Invicta Racing, has his team currently top of the Teams' Championship Standings. The yellow machines lead Spanish outfit Campos, who are second. DAMS Lucas Oil, MP Motorsport and Hitech TGR are all very much within a chance with four rounds remaining. The round at Monza can often be pivotal in FIA Formula 2. Last year, Gabriel Bortoleto made history by winning the Feature Race after starting in 22nd and back of the grid. It was a driver that pushed him on a title charge and pushed him closer to a full time Formula One drive. The iconic Monza circuit is one of just 11 turns and many long straights that help the lap distance rise to 5.793km. Two DRS zones at Monza make it a great circuit for overtaking with the best chance appearing down the start/finish straight. Two races per weekend is usual for FIA Formula 2 and at Monza, this time out it's no different. 21 laps are to take place in Saturday's Sprint Race while 30 laps are competing in Sunday's Feature Race.
